Born and raised in Chicago, Brandon’s journey began when he became the world’s youngest professional jamskater (i.e. breakdancing on roller skates). He quickly decided to leave home and move to California at the age of 16 in pursuit of his numerous dreams. Brandon found success in Hollywood when he joined the acclaimed Netflix series, The OA (2016). Brandon’s Breakthrough project was starring in Jordan Peele’s critically-lauded film, NOPE (2022) as Angel Torres opposite Daniel Kaluuya, Keke Palmer, and Steven Yeun.  

Brandon, who is proudly half Puerto Rican and half Filipino, currently resides in Los Angeles. When he’s not on set, you will find Brandon enjoying time with family and friends, breakdancing, boxing, tricking (freestyle flipping), martial arts, BMX biking, and rock climbing.
